Frequently Asked Questions

What exactly is secondary containment for gases?

It is a **redundant, leak‑tight barrier** that surrounds the primary vessel or pipeline, designed to capture any accidental release and direct it to a safe collection system, complying with ATEX, OSHA, and IEC safety codes.
